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
83607451320 04632820 41
852285 53880277
852285 53880277
7405976 174305 1658487909 35719914
All about undefined
Interested in learning more?
852285 53880277
7405976 174305 1658487909 35719914
See more
905 046488042 4362788964
723 015834404 4871
See more
05425938 180562 792
9410709001 9528655 892
See more